你的数据到底存在哪?云端存储和数据库是一回事吗?云端存储与数据库的区别,你的数据究竟存于何处?
你有没有想过,手机里几千张照片、聊天记录、购物订单都藏在哪?
昨天帮邻居王姐修手机时,她指着相册里灰掉的图片急得直跺脚:"我明明上传到云端了呀!"这种困惑相信你也遇到过——明明每天都在用网盘存文件、用APP查数据,却搞不清云端存储和数据库到底有什么区别。今天我们就来扒开这两个技术的"外套",看看它们怎么在数字世界里各司其职。
一、数据世界的"两居室":存储间和档案库
举个栗子:你网购时的订单详情页,商品图片存在云端存储,价格库存存在数据库。
云端存储就像超大储物间:专门收留各种"散装"文件,照片、视频、PDF随便扔。比如百度网盘存你旅游照片,微信语音存在腾讯云(网页6提到这类场景)。
数据库更像精装档案室:把数据分门别类装进表格,比如淘宝订单里的商品编号、价格、下单时间,都整整齐齐躺在MySQL这类数据库里(网页8里说的订单数据库案例)。
关键区别看这里:
对比项 | 云端存储 | 数据库 |
---|---|---|
数据类型 | 照片/视频等"乱放型" | 订单/用户信息等"规整型" |
查找方式 | 按文件名大海捞针 | 用SQL语句精准定位 |
典型应用 | 网盘/相册备份 | 购物车/会员系统 |
二、这对"邻居"怎么互相串门?
去年帮朋友公司做系统迁移时发现,他们的用户头像存在阿里云OSS(对象存储),用户信息存在云数据库。这俩技术经常组团出道:
- 数据分家:重要资料在数据库记目录,大文件存在云端。就像图书馆的电子借阅系统,书目信息在数据库,电子书PDF存在云端(网页7的MySQL+云存储方案)
- 性能互补:遇到双十一秒杀,数据库处理订单,商品图从云端快速加载。某电商平台实测,这种组合让页面加载速度提升40%(网页4提到的案例)
- 成本分摊:把10TB的视频教学资源扔给云端存储,每月省下3台服务器费用。某在线教育平台靠这招年省百万(网页5的弹性扩展优势)
但有时候也会打架:
- 去年某社交APP把聊天记录误存数据库,导致服务器卡成PPT(网页6提醒的结构化数据重要性)
- 有公司把客户资料直接扔网盘,结果被爬虫扒个精光(网页2强调的数据安全风险)
三、小白必知的三大生存法则
1. 存照片选云端,查订单找数据库
就像你不会把身份证复印件塞进文件柜,重要凭证类数据(银行卡号、住址)必须进数据库。而随手拍的天空晚霞,扔云端存储更划算(网页3提到的统计分析数据存储建议)
2. 双备份才靠谱
见过最狠的操作是:数据库每天自动备份到云端存储,云端文件又同步到另一个数据库。虽然麻烦,但去年他们遭遇勒索病毒时,靠这招半小时恢复全部数据(网页4的灾备方案)
3. 别被"无限空间"忽悠
某网盘宣称永久免费,结果第二年就关停。现在我把家庭相册同时存阿里云OSS和本地硬盘,云端数据库定期导出CSV文件(网页5的混合云策略提醒)
灵魂拷问:这俩技术未来会合并吗?
最近测试了亚马逊的S3智能分层存储,发现它已经开始识别图片内容。而Google的BigQuery数据库,现在能直接分析云端存储里的CSV文件(网页5提到的智能数据库趋势)。
或许再过五年,我们不再需要区分存储和数据库。就像现在的智能手机,早把相机、MP3、游戏机融为一体。但至少在2025年的今天,这对"黄金搭档"还是各有所长——一个管吃饱,一个管吃好。
小编观点:与其纠结选哪个,不如先理清手头的数据类型。记住,结构化数据进数据库,非结构化文件存云端,这个基本原则能帮你避开90%的坑(网页3][网页6][网页8]的综合结论)。下次存文件时,不妨先问自己:这数据需要经常检索修改吗?答案会告诉你该敲哪个邻居的门。